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are motorized lorries created to help people who have problem walking due to different health conditions, such as arthritis, multiple sclerosis, or general mobility disabilities. These scooters are geared up with a comfy seat, a steering mechanism, and an electric motor, enabling users to take a trip brief to moderate ranges with ease. They are especially helpful for navigating both indoor and outdoor environments, such as grocery stores, parks, and public spaces.
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Three-Wheel Scooters
Pros: More maneuverable, lighter, and easier to save.Cons: Less stable on rough surface.Best For: Indoor use, tight areas, and users who focus on dexterity.
Four-Wheel Scooters

Travel Scooters
Pros: Portable and simple to dismantle for transport.Cons: May have limited variety and speed.Best For: Users who take a trip often or reside in homes.
Heavy Duty Scooters
Pros: Built to support greater weight capabilities and more robust use.Cons: Larger and heavier, making them less portable.Best For: Users with greater body weights or those who need a more durable alternative.
Standing Scooters

Battery Life and Range
Variety: How far the scooter can take a trip on a single charge.Battery Type: Lithium-ion batteries are typically more effective and longer-lasting than lead-acid batteries.
Speed
Indoor Speed: Typically lower, around 4-6 mph.Outside Speed: Can be greater, as much as 10-15 mph, depending on the model.
Weight Capacity
Basic: 250-300 pounds.Strong: 400-500 pounds or more.
Turning Radius

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?A: Some insurance coverage plans, consisting of Medicare, may cover the expense of a mobility scooter under specific conditions. It's essential to talk to your insurance coverage supplier to comprehend what is covered and any needed documents.

Q: How do I preserve my mobility scooter?A: Regular maintenance is crucial to keep your scooter running efficiently. This includes:
Charging the Battery: Follow the maker's standards for charging.Examining Tires: Ensure tires are properly pumped up and in good condition.Lubing Moving Parts: Periodically lubricate the chain and other moving parts.Cleaning up: Keep the scooter clean and dry to prevent rust and wear.
Q: What are the legal requirements for using a mobility scooter?A: Legal requirements differ by area. Normally, mobility scooters are classified as mobility help and do not need a license to operate. Nevertheless, it's important to:
Check Local Regulations: Some locations may have specific guidelines concerning where and how mobility scooters can be utilized.Register the Scooter: In some areas, registration may be needed, particularly if the scooter is used on public roads.
Q: How do I select the best mobility scooter for my requirements?A: Consider the following:
Intended Use: Will you be utilizing the scooter mainly inside, outdoors, or both?Weight and Height: Ensure the scooter can support your weight and is adjustable to your height.Mobility Level: Choose a scooter that matches your level of mobility and any physical constraints.Budget: Determine how much you want to spend and search for designs that provide the best value.
Q: Are there any security pointers for using a mobility scooter?A: Yes, here are some security tips:
Wear a Helmet: Especially if you are utilizing the scooter on public roads.Use Reflective Gear: Increase presence throughout low-light conditions.Follow Traffic Rules: Obey traffic signals and indications, and utilize designated paths when readily available.Routine Check-ups: Have your scooter inspected and preserved by a professional regularly.
